Typical Types of Damage to UPVC Panels


UPVC panels are not resistant to damage. Here are some of the most typical kinds of damage that property owners may experience:

Damage Type

Description

Scratches

Surface-level abrasions that mar the appearance of the panel.

Damages

Imprints triggered by effect or heavy items.

Staining

Fading of color due to prolonged exposure to sunlight or other aspects.

Cracks

Structural damage that can compromise the integrity of the panel.

Contorting

Deformation of the panel due to severe heat or moisture.

4. Fixing Scratches and Minor Dents

For Scratches:

  1. Sand the scratched location lightly with fine-grit sandpaper.
  2. Clean the location again to get rid of dust.
  3. Apply UPVC polish to restore shine.

For Dents:

  1. Use an utility knife to gently scrape away any loose product around the dent.
  2. Fill the dent using UPVC filler, smoothing it out with a putty knife.
  3. Once dried, sand the area with fine-grit sandpaper for an even surface area.
  4. Polish the location as required.

5. Repairing Cracks

  1. Broaden the crack somewhat with an energy knife so that it can be filled effectively.
  2. Tidy the fracture completely.
  3. Apply UPVC adhesive or filler, ensuring it permeates deep into the crack.
  4. Use a putty knife to smooth the surface area.
  5. Once dry, sand the area to blend it with the remainder of the panel.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)


1. The length of time do UPVC panels last?

UPVC panels can last 20-30 years with proper care and maintenance. Routine examination for signs of wear can help extend their life-span.

2. Can I repair a broken UPVC panel myself?

Yes, small repair work such as scratches, damages, and small fractures can often be done by homeowners with fundamental tools and products. Nevertheless, for considerable damage, it's advisable to consult a professional.

3. What is the best way to clean UPVC panels?

4. Will sunshine cause damage to UPVC panels?

Yes, extended exposure to sunshine can cause discoloration and surface area deterioration. Using UV-resistant paint can help mitigate this impact.

5. Can UPVC panels be painted?

Yes, UPVC panels can be painted. It's necessary to utilize specially developed UPVC paint for the very best adhesion and finish.
